To: Executive Team
Cc: Branch Managers
Subject: Discount policy for large deals

Effective next month, discounts on orders above 200 units of the Harrowfield range require written approval from regional finance before the quote is issued. Standing authority for branch managers caps at 12%. Anything beyond that must include a margin impact statement. Please brief your account teams carefully, as exceptions will not be honoured retroactively. A confidential note on our wider plans follows directly below.

board note of tadup-tajog: Headcount on the Oliiel team goes from 31 to 88 by the end of February. Gross margin on Oliiel came in at 62 percent against a plan of 29 percent.

Subject: New turnstiles in the Fenholt lobby — what you need to know

Welcome aboard! From Monday, the old swipe gates in the Fenholt lobby are replaced with optical turnstiles. Tap your badge flat against the reader and wait for the green arrow before walking through — tailgating triggers an alarm. If your badge hasn't been activated yet, use the accessibility gate on the left, which accepts the temporary entry code below.

staff pass of tagef-kawif = bdg-CD-0

## Step 7: Turn on payload compression

Okay, this is the fun one. Pendant used to ship telemetry uncompressed, which was fine until the fleet tripled and the collectors started sweating. Version 12 adds zstd compression on the agent side — it cuts bandwidth by roughly 70% and the collectors decompress transparently, so nothing downstream changes. Just don't enable it before every collector is on 12, or they'll choke. Flip the agents over using these settings.

settings of yahag-yafog:
[pramir]
host = pramir.qirvancorp.internal
user = pramir_svc
database = pramir_prod

For the sales leads at Brindlecote Systems: the proposed training budget for next year stands 9% above current spend, reflecting the rollout of the Ferrow certification track and expanded onboarding in the Halveston office. Finance lead Oskar Penwright confirmed that coaching sessions for the Lanternfall product line are fully funded, while conference travel is capped. Unspent Q4 allocations will not roll forward. How these figures connect to our wider direction is set out in the confidential note that follows.

management briefing: Project Sorius slips by two quarters because of the audit delay.